Kayshon Boutte wants a new contract and is unhappy with his role as the number four receiver behind A.J. Brown, Romeo Doubs, and Pop Douglas with the New England Patriots. After operating as the team's primary red zone weapon and arguably their most important receiver in 2025 (since Diggs did not play a full complement of snaps), Boutte is looking for a clearer path to snaps as he works towards a new contract. He is much more than just the vertical threat the Patriots deployed him as last season and should have no shortage of suitors on the trade market at the right price. New England will likely demand a pick commensurate with what they would get as a compensatory pick if Boutte left in free agency next offseason. Boutte is a buy low in dynasty and a late round dart throw for best ball purposes.
